A Columbus man is facing two felonies after police said he tried to break into a Ninth Avenue North business this weekend and then flee in a stolen vehicle.
Officers with the Columbus Police Department arrested Patrick Denver Alexander, 23, of 1227 Casey Lane, on Sunday. They had gone to Acme Window Tint about 11:25 a.m. in response to an alarm activation, according to a CPD media release.
Authorities said they found Alexander at the scene and he attempted to steal a vehicle and leave the area.
Alexander has been charged with burglary of a commercial business and felony taking of a motor vehicle.
His bond was set at $25,000.
